Can I use a virtual office for google my business

Yes you can use a virtual office address to set up a google my business profile and gain more visibility in google search. However the virtual office provider must meet some specific requirements in order for you to be able to use your virtual office address to claim your google my business listing.

The guidelines for representing your business on Google states that:

1. Listings on google my business can only be created for businesses that either have a physical location that customers can visit, or that travel to visit customers where they are.

According to this rule, you are allowed a virtual office address as long as your provider gives you the opportunity to use their offices when you need them (just like kimbocorp does). Even though you run your business remotely, your provider should allow you to access professional, tech-enabled meeting rooms and boardrooms to conduct your business meetings and meet your customers.

2. Service-area businesses can't list a "virtual office" unless that office is staffed during opening hours
